Acalabrutinib Impurities & Reference Standards

Invenza supplies high-quality Acalabrutinib Reference Standards, Acalabrutinib impurities, pharmacopeial and non-pharmacopeial impurities, metabolites, stable isotope-labeled compounds, and nitrosamine-related products for pharmaceutical research, analytical testing, and quality control applications.

Our Acalabrutinib impurity reference standards are suitable for a wide range of pharmaceutical and analytical applications, including drug development, analytical method development and validation, quality control (QC), stability studies, impurity profiling, unknown impurity identification, regulatory submissions such as ANDA and DMF, and assessment of potential genotoxic impurities.

Acalabrutinib-related reference standards are thoroughly characterized and supplied with Certificates of Analysis (COA) and supporting analytical data, subject to product availability and applicable specifications.
